How much do closing manager j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 10, 2026, the average hourly pay for closing manager in Springfield, IL is $16.51,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$13.80 and $17.88 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the responsibilities of a closing manager?

The responsibilities of a real estate closing manager include working with processors, underwriters, and other professionals to complete all the necessary documents for mortgage loans. They are expected to hire, train, supervise, and guide closers to help improve their efficiency and sales. Additional duties include analyzing any relevant title or escrow to ensure compliance with federal and state regulations. A closing manager often coordinates the closing schedule, helps the settlement agent with changes, and completes a post-close review.

What is a closing manager?

A closing manager is a supervisory role responsible for overseeing the final operations of a business or store at the end of the day, including cash handling, ensuring security, and completing daily reports. They often coordinate with staff to ensure all tasks are completed accurately and efficiently, and may require experience in management and familiarity with point-of-sale systems.

What is the role of a closing manager?

A closing manager oversees the final operations of a business shift, ensuring all tasks are completed accurately and efficiently. They handle cash reconciliation, staff coordination, and ensure compliance with safety and company policies, often using point-of-sale systems and management tools.

What are some common challenges a closing manager faces when coordinating with multiple departments during the closing process?

A Closing Manager often encounters challenges in aligning timelines and requirements among various departments, such as sales, legal, and finance. Ensuring all documentation is accurate and submitted on time can be complex, especially when last-minute issues arise. Effective communication and problem-solving skills are essential to manage competing priorities and avoid delays. Proactively identifying potential bottlenecks and maintaining clear, consistent updates with all stakeholders can help ensure a smooth closing process.
